Transaction 1c7660ee374f6ccb3bc33b035d2484ec9a744b3677b1227efd0e7fbc4c1f80ec
1 Input
1 Output
-
1c7660ee374f6ccb3bc33b035d2484ec9a744b3677b1227efd0e7fbc4c1f80ec:0
- value
- 25232766
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 896a69f904a6474173d58605d059a7ba735c1bac O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DXb4426UwZD7qLZExCsu1eMpnw3VhNE8e